Formation Overview & Key Roles in the 4-3-1-2

Before adjusting custom tactics, you need to understand the basic structure of the 4-3-1-2 and what each position is expected to do.

Core Shape of the 4-3-1-2

The 4-3-1-2 is a narrow formation with:

  • 4 defenders (RB, 2 CBs, LB)
  • 3 central midfielders (LCM, CM, RCM)
  • 1 central attacking midfielder (CAM)
  • 2 strikers (ST, ST)

Because there are no natural wingers, your width comes mainly from fullbacks and clever movement from the CAM and strikers. This makes the formation excellent for quick, direct play through the middle but vulnerable if you lose the ball and your fullbacks are too high.

Key Roles and Player Profiles

To get the best out of 4-3-1-2 in EA FC 26, try to match players to these profiles:

  • Strikers (STs): Ideally one pacey runner and one more physical or technical finisher. A combination like a rapid striker plus a strong target man or a 5-star skill forward works very well.
  • CAM: Your main playmaker. Look for high passing, agility, balance and at least 4★ skills. A good long shot trait is a bonus.
  • LCM/RCM: Box-to-box midfielders with good stamina, interceptions and passing. They support both attack and defense.
  • CM (CDM-style CM): Your defensive anchor. Treat this spot like a CDM: strong tackling, good positioning, and medium/high or low/high work rates.
  • Fullbacks: You want pace and stamina. They provide width, so being able to bomb up and down the pitch is crucial.
  • Center-backs: Physical, quick enough to catch meta attackers, and good on the ball if possible.

Best 4-3-1-2 Custom Tactics for FUT Champions

Below is a balanced but competitive 4-3-1-2 setup tailored for FUT Champions in EA FC 26. You can tweak it slightly based on personal preference, but this gives a strong base that fits the current meta.

Defensive Settings

Open your custom tactics page and set the defensive part as follows:

  • Defensive Style: Balanced (or Pressure on Heavy Touch if you are confident)
  • Width: 40–45
  • Depth: 55–62

Why? The 4-3-1-2 is naturally compact. A width around 40–45 keeps your midfield tight so opponents struggle to play through the center. A depth around 55–62 gives you active pressing without committing to an all‑out high line that can be punished by through balls.

Offensive Settings

Next, configure your attacking style and chance creation:

  • Build Up Play: Balanced (or Fast Build Up if you like direct counters)
  • Chance Creation: Direct Passing
  • Offensive Width: 45–55
  • Players in Box: 6
  • Corners: 2
  • Free Kicks: 2

Direct Passing is extremely effective in narrow formations. Once you enter the final third, your strikers and CAM make aggressive runs into space, creating those triangle passing lanes that make the 4-3-1-2 so dangerous. An offensive width around 50 keeps the shape tight but not congested.

Alternative Aggressive & Defensive Variants

For FUT Champions, it is smart to have multiple custom tactics saved:

  • Ultra Defensive 4-3-1-2: Drop Depth to 35–40, Defensive Style to Balanced, Players in Box to 4. Use this when defending a lead late in the game.
  • Ultra Attack 4-3-1-2: Depth 70+, Build Up Play Fast Build Up, Chance Creation Forward Runs. This is risky but perfect when you need a last-minute equalizer.

Optimal Player Instructions for 4-3-1-2

Player instructions are what truly shape how your 4-3-1-2 behaves on the pitch. Below is a tried-and-tested setup that balances attack and defense.

Strikers (ST & ST)

  • Attacking Runs: Get In Behind
  • Support Runs: Mixed Attack
  • Defensive Support: Basic Defense Support

If you have one physical striker, you can set him to Target Man while keeping Get In Behind on your pacey forward. This combination helps you vary your attacks: one drops or holds the ball, the other runs in behind.

CAM

  • Defensive Support: Come Back on Defense (optional but recommended)
  • Chance Creation: Stay Forward or Balanced
  • Positioning Freedom: Free Roam

The CAM is your link between midfield and attack. Free Roam allows him to drift into pockets of space, pull defenders out of position, and open passing lanes for your strikers. If you struggle defensively, set him to Come Back on Defense for extra compactness.

Three Central Midfielders (LCM, CM, RCM)

Split roles within your midfield for balance.

Central CM (Defensive Midfielder):

  • Attacking Support: Stay Back While Attacking
  • Defensive Position: Stay Back / Cover Center
  • Interceptions: Normal or Aggressive if stamina is high

LCM & RCM (Box-to-Box):

  • Attacking Support: Balanced Attack
  • Defensive Position: Cover Center
  • Interceptions: Normal

If you find yourself being countered too often, you may change one of your side CMs to Stay Back While Attacking. Otherwise, keeping them on balanced gives you extra runs into the box, especially late in games.

Fullbacks (LB & RB)

  • Attacking Runs: Stay Back While Attacking (default) or Balanced if you want more width
  • Run Type: Overlap
  • Interceptions: Normal

Because the 4-3-1-2 is narrow, Overlap is vital for creating width when you do send your fullbacks forward. In FUT Champions, many players prefer Stay Back While Attacking for safety, then occasionally trigger runs manually using L1/LB. Choose based on your risk tolerance.

Center-Backs & Goalkeeper

  • CBs: Stay Back While Attacking, Normal Interceptions
  • GK: Comes for Crosses, Sweeper Keeper (if you trust your reactions)

With through balls being very strong in EA FC 26, a Sweeper Keeper can save you in 1v1 situations. However, if you feel uncomfortable, leave him on the default setting.

How to Play the 4-3-1-2 Effectively in EA FC 26

Even the best custom tactics will not help if you do not play to the formation's strengths. Here is how to get the most out of your setup in FUT Champions.

Attacking Principles

Focus on short, sharp passes through the middle, mainly involving your CMs, CAM and strikers. Use quick one‑twos and driven passes to break lines. When the ball reaches your CAM, look for:

  • A through ball to a striker running in behind
  • A pass to an overlapping CM moving into the half-space
  • A quick give-and-go to create shooting space at the top of the box

If your opponent parks the bus, patiently recycle the ball between midfield and defense to pull them out of shape. Do not be afraid to shoot from the edge of the box with your CAM or CMs when space opens up.

Defensive Principles

Defensively, try to manually control your midfielders rather than constantly dragging center-backs out of position. The narrow shape makes it easier to cut passing lanes into your opponent's striker or CAM. Use jockeying and second-man press sparingly – over-committing is the main way you will concede with this formation.

Smart In-Game Adjustments

In FUT Champions, momentum and opponent playstyle vary a lot. Be ready to adjust on the fly:

  • If you are under constant pressure: lower depth by 5–10 points and set CMs to Stay Back While Attacking.
  • If you cannot break down a low block: switch Build Up Play to Fast Build Up or Chance Creation to Forward Runs for more aggressive movement.
  • If your opponent relies on crosses: keep fullbacks on Stay Back While Attacking and your GK on Comes for Crosses.

Extra Tips: Chemistry, Meta Cards & Common Mistakes

Once your tactics and squad are in place, small optimizations can still make a big difference.

Chemistry & Positioning

  • Always use correct position modifiers so players are on full chemistry wherever possible.
  • Prioritize chemistry on your spine (CB–CM–CAM–ST) first – that is where the 4-3-1-2 lives or dies.
  • Use managers and league links to connect hybrids; a strong league-based core can reduce chemistry headaches.

What to Look for in Meta Cards

Although the specific best cards change throughout EA FC 26, some attributes are consistently valuable in a 4-3-1-2:

  • Strikers: 4★+ weak foot, high sprint speed/acceleration, good composure and finishing.
  • CAM: High vision, passing and dribbling; traits like Finesse Shot or Outside Foot Shot are very useful.
  • CMs: Stamina, interceptions, short passing and decent pace so they are not left behind in transitions.
  • Defenders: Pace and defensive awareness are crucial against the constant threat of through balls.

Common Mistakes with the 4-3-1-2

Try to avoid these frequent errors players make with this formation:

  • Overcommitting fullbacks: Sending both fullbacks forward at once leaves your CBs exposed. Use overlap selectively.
  • Forcing passes: Because the formation is narrow, it can be tempting to force passes through crowded areas. Stay patient and recycle the ball.
  • Dragging CBs out of position: Step with CMs first. Only switch to a CB when you really need to challenge.
  • Ignoring stamina: Your midfield works very hard. Make smart substitutions around the 60–70th minute when playing FUT Champions.
